Salik is Dubai’s electronic toll system, run by Salik Company PJSC, the emirate’s exclusive toll gate operator under a 49-year concession from the RTA running to 2071, using RFID and number-plate recognition with no barriers.

How much does Salik cost per crossing?

Since 31 January 2025, Salik uses variable pricing: AED 6 per crossing in peak hours, AED 4 off-peak and AED 0 past midnight, replacing the previous flat AED 4 fare (Salik Company PJSC H1 2025 results). Two new gates, at the Business Bay Crossing and Al Safa South on Sheikh Zayed Road, were activated on 24 November 2024 (RTA). Scale is significant: Salik recorded 424.2 million total trips in the first half of 2025.

For a fleet, Salik is a per-trip cost that varies with route and time of day, so it belongs in per-vehicle trip costing, not in overheads.
